什么网站适合练习编程

fiy 其他 11

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在网上有很多适合练习编程的网站,以下是一些常见的选择:

    1. LeetCode:LeetCode是一个面向编程面试准备的平台,提供了各种编程题目,覆盖了不同的难度级别和各种编程语言。通过解决这些题目,可以提升算法和编程能力。

    2. Codecademy:Codecademy是一个在线学习编程的平台,提供了丰富的课程和项目,适合初学者和有一定基础的编程爱好者。学习者可以通过互动式的编程环境来学习和实践。

    3. HackerRank:HackerRank是一个面向开发者的技能测评和编程挑战平台,提供了各种编程题目和竞赛,支持多种编程语言。在这个平台上,可以与其他开发者竞争,提升编程能力。

    4. Codewars:Codewars是一个以编程挑战为核心的社交平台,用户可以通过解决各种难度级别的编程题目来提升技能。在这个平台上,还可以与其他用户交流和分享解决方案。

    5. Project Euler:Project Euler是一个以数学和计算机科学问题为主题的挑战平台,提供了一系列有趣而具有挑战性的问题。通过解决这些问题,可以提升数学建模和算法设计的能力。

    除了上述网站,还有许多其他的编程练习网站,如CodeSignal、Topcoder、Exercism等,都可以根据个人的需求和兴趣进行选择。重要的是在练习编程的过程中保持持续的学习和实践,不断提升自己的编程能力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在互联网上有很多适合练习编程的网站。以下是一些受欢迎的网站:

    1. LeetCode
      LeetCode是一个专门用于算法和数据结构练习的网站。它提供了许多实际工作面试中常见的编程问题,并提供在线编译器和自动化评审系统,帮助用户测试和改进他们的解决方案。LeetCode的题目非常实用,涵盖了各种编程语言和难度级别。

    2. HackerRank
      HackerRank是一个综合性编程练习平台,旨在帮助开发者提升他们的编程技能。它提供了许多不同类型的题目,包括算法、数据结构、数学、人工智能等领域。HackerRank还有一个代码竞赛的功能,可以让用户与其他人进行比赛。

    3. Codecademy
      Codecademy是一个针对初学者的在线编程学习平台。它提供了一系列的课程和项目,涵盖了多种编程语言和技术。用户可以通过交互式的编码环境学习和实践编程知识,从而快速上手编程。

    4. FreeCodeCamp
      FreeCodeCamp是一个免费的学习编程的社区。它提供了一系列的课程和项目,涵盖了HTML、CSS、JavaScript等前端技术,以及Node.js、Express等后端技术。用户可以通过完成项目和实践来提升他们的编程能力。

    5. Codewars
      Codewars是一个编程社区,旨在通过解决编程难题来提升开发者的技能。它提供了数千个难题,用户可以选择自己感兴趣的题目和难度级别进行练习。Codewars还有一个排行榜系统,可以比较自己的解决方案与其他用户的优劣。

    总结
    以上这些网站都是非常适合练习编程的,无论是初学者还是有经验的开发者都可以从中受益。通过在这些网站上解决问题和完成项目,可以提升自己的算法和编程能力,并且与其他开发者进行交流和比较。无论选择哪个网站,重要的是持续学习和实践,不断提升自己的编程技能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    网站选择没有一个固定答案,因为不同人对于编程练习的需求和兴趣也不同。但是,有一些常见的网站适合练习编程技能,推荐如下:

    1. LeetCode(https://leetcode.com/)
      LeetCode 是一个专注于算法题目的在线编程平台,提供了各种难度和类型的算法题目,适合练习算法和数据结构的能力。它提供了实时的运行结果和提交答案的功能,还有一个讨论区可以查看他人的解题方法和思路。

    2. HackerRank(https://www.hackerrank.com/)
      HackerRank 是一个面向开发者的技术挑战平台,提供了各种类型的编程题目,涵盖了广泛的编程语言和领域。它提供了一系列的挑战和竞赛,可以通过完成这些挑战来提高自己的编程能力。

    3. Codecademy(https://www.codecademy.com/)
      Codecademy 是一个致力于教授编程知识的在线学习平台,提供了许多不同的编程课程,涵盖了编程的各个方面,例如 Python、JavaScript、HTML/CSS等。它通过交互式的学习方式,帮助学习者通过实践编程来提高自己的技能。

    4. Project Euler(https://projecteuler.net/)
      Project Euler 是一个数学和计算机科学问题的在线平台,提供了一系列有趣的数学问题需要通过编程来解决。它的问题通常比较具有挑战性,需要结合数学知识和编程技巧来解决。

    5. Codewars(https://www.codewars.com/)
      Codewars 是一个社区驱动的编程挑战平台,提供了各种难度的编程题目。在 Codewars 上,你可以完成挑战来提升自己的编码技能,并通过与其他用户的比较来看看自己的水平。

    6. GitHub(https://github.com/)
      GitHub 是一个面向开发者的代码托管平台,提供了各种开源项目可以供学习和贡献。在 GitHub 上,你可以找到与自己兴趣相关的项目,阅读别人的代码,学习他们的实现方法。

    以上只是一些常见的编程练习网站,你可以根据自己的需求和兴趣来选择适合自己的网站进行编程练习。另外,还可以尝试参加编程俱乐部、在线课程等方式来获取更系统化的编程训练。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部